The restarted AMA Superbike race at Mid-Ohio was red-flagged again after an additional three laps, when Matt Lynn crashed and his tumbling Honda CBR1000RR ignited. Miguel Duhamel crashed immediately after Lynn, and this time race control quickly called for a red flag. Lynn waved for cornerworkers to bring a fire extinguisher but they refused to venture out into the impact zone until the race was red-flagged. Lynn then met a cornerworker walking out with a fire extinguisher, grabbed the extinguisher and ran to put his burning Corona Extra Honda out. When the red flag was thrown, Mat Mladin was leading Ben Spies and Jamie Hacking, who had been delayed by fast-starting Eric Bostrom; Bostrom was fourth as the red flag flew. The riders were working the 11th total lap, including all laps scored during the original start and restarts. Flying debris from Lynn’s crash hit Scott Jensen in the knee; Jensen said his left knee was swollen and “locked up” as a result.
